The florfenicol resistance gene (pp-flo) derived from a transferable R-plasmid of Pasteurella piscicida consisted of 1, 122 nucleotides, and the predicted amino acid sequence showed 47.4% identity to that of a non-enzymatic chloramphenicol resistance gene (cmlA). The pp-flo gene was located in the downstream region of the sulfonamide resistance gene of the transferable R-plasmid.
